Li Na was the reigning champion, but chose not to defend her title as she retired from professional tennis on 19 September 2014.

Serena Williams won the title, defeating Maria Sharapova in the final, 6–3, 7–6(7–5), to earn her sixth Australian Open title and her 19th Grand Slam singles title overall, tying the record with Helen Wills Moody.

All of the top four seeds (Williams, Sharapova, Simona Halep, and Petra Kvitová) were in contention for the world no. 1 ranking at the start of the tournament. Williams retained the top position by reaching the final.

This was the last Grand Slam tournament for former World No. 2 player Vera Zvonareva.
